Job Description

Por qué es importante este trabajo

The Project Professional supports the planning, execution and delivery of complex projects through all specific phases, in alignment with BT Group strategies and external customer contractual requirements.

Qué harás

1. Works with an integrated team in the delivery of end-to-end small-scale projects/ programmes contributing to commercial benefit, deliver on time, within budget and to agreed quality criteria from conception through to market launch and transition into operations.
2. Supports complex and large-scale projects with regional impact (cross-functional), coordinating through delivery of execution, analysis, recommendation and implementation whilst ensuring a base level of technical specialism proficiency.
3. Supports issue escalations, identifies project risks, dependencies and project changes, ensuring timely intervention and communication to stakeholders.
4. Supports the development, documentation and implementation of projects and change initiatives in line with BT Group policies and strategies, defining and maintaining realistic project plans and tracking project finances and progress against agreed quality and performance criteria.
5. Supports timely reporting on project performance and where decision making is required, providing all information needed to enable well-informed decision making.
6. Reviews, suggests and executes process improvements and efficiencies with the engagement and delivery models.
7. Supports the definition, documentation and execution of small projects or sub-projects, agreeing and reviewing project approach, engagement and communications plans, and quality and performance criteria with project partners.
8. Supports in the implementation of ways to improve working processes within the area of Project/Programme Management & PMO.
9. Facilitates effective working relationships between team members, and develops business/ customer and partner relationships, handling problems and issues, collecting and disseminating relevant information.
10. Proactively identifies and manages risk through regular assessment and diligent execution of controls and mitigations, proactively raising any concerns.
11. Ensures project delivery activity complies with the commercial obligations, risks and interdependencies defined within external delivery contract for their projects.
